Abstract

The utility model provides a reinforced combustion fly ash reburning type boiler of a coal-throwing machine, which comprises a boiler main body of a coal-throwing machine, wherein the front wall of a boiler chamber is provided with a front arch; a separator is arranged in a flue; an ash containing hopper and an ash conveying pipe are arranged below the separator; the ash conveying pipe stretches into the boiler chamber. The utility model can reduce the fume dust drainage quantity and the blackness of the fume dust of the coal-throwing machine boiler, can improve the coal burn-out rate of carbon, and can reduce energy consumption.

Description

Overheavy firing fly-ash reburning formula spreader stoker boliler
The utility model relates to a kind of boiler.
Spreader feeder forward-moving grate boiler is by machinery or mechanical wind-force coal to be thrown the stove internal combustion, it large coal particles throw far away, that small-particle coal is thrown is near, adopts the fire grate reversing to adapt with it.Because ickings causes the boiler over-emitting black exhaust with the flue gas burner hearth that flies out, the unburned carbon in flue dust height, deadly defects such as energy consumption height, relevant department give stricts orders before 2000 as can not solve the problem of spreader stoker boliler over-emitting black exhaust, will force manufacturing firm's stopping production.But spreader stoker boliler is half suspension combustion, and coal adaptability is strong, starts soon, and the Load Regulation ability is strong, will be brought very big technology, loss economically in case abolish.Therefore the over-emitting black exhaust problem that solves spreader stoker boliler is extensively paid attention to.Two kinds of solutions are arranged in the prior art.A kind of is to increase primary dust removing, and the carbon containing flying dust in the flue gas is caught, and reduces smoke content, in the hope of reaching environmental requirement, this technical scheme need increase a deduster and change bigger blower fan for steam generator system, and can not cut down the consumption of energy, and invests very big.Be to increase the fire grate burning capacity in another, water-cooling wall intersects in stove to catch flying dust before and after changing, and this technical scheme retrofit work amount is other big, serious wear in the expense height, stove, and effect is not so good.
The purpose of this utility model is to provide a kind of can reduce content of harmful and the overheavy firing fly-ash reburning formula spreader stoker boliler that cuts down the consumption of energy in the flue gas.
The purpose of this utility model is achieved in that it comprises the spreader stoker boliler main body, and a face arch is installed on the antetheca of burner hearth, is provided with a separator in flue, has one to connect ash bucket and extend into the interior ash feeding pipe of burner hearth under the separator.
Advantage of the present utility model is: be provided with face arch in burner hearth, and the size of face arch is bigger, the end points of face arch will surpass the center line of burner hearth usually.Burner hearth is divided into overheavy firing chamber and secondary furnace, and it can play three effects.The one, improve ignition temperature, increase combustion intensity, the 2nd, face arch is caught a part of fly ash particle, makes it to drop on the fire grate to burn away, the 3rd, air-flow forms S shape, prolongs the tail-off time of particle.Separator in the flue and the ash bucket behind the separator, ash feeding pipe are separated unburnt carbon containing flying dust, send into fire grate again behind the stove again and burn.The utility model can reduce the smoke discharge amount and the flue dust blackness of spreader stoker boliler greatly, improves the burn-off rate of carbon.The technical solution of the utility model is want can improve the efficiency of combustion of 7-15% than improving exerting oneself of 5-10% with former spreader stoker boliler, and the flue dust blackness drops to below the Lin Geman one-level, reaches environmental protection standard.Its improvement cost is low, transforms to take by energy-conservation and regains in 7 months.The technical solution of the utility model can be used for the manufacturing of new boiler, also can be used for the transformation of existing spreader stoker boliler.
Fig. 1 and Fig. 2 are the structural representations of two kinds of embodiments of the utility model.
For example the utility model is done more detailed description below in conjunction with accompanying drawing: in conjunction with Fig. 1.Face arch 2 is installed on the antetheca of the burner hearth of spreader stoker boliler main body 1, and the antetheca place of common spreader stoker boliler burner hearth generally is equipped with water-cooling wall, and face arch of the present utility model promptly replaces water-cooling wall and is installed on former water-cooling wall place.The end points of face arch surpasses the burner hearth center line.Separator 3 is a kind of in groove separator, louver separator or the cyclone separator, and it is installed in the reversal chamber.Ash bucket 4 is arranged at the bottom of separator.Pick ash pipe 5 behind the ash bucket, ash feeding pipe extend into the rear portion of burner hearth.Use of the present utility model is identical with common spreader stoker boliler, adopts machinery or machinery to combine with wind-force coal is thrown to the burner hearth internal combustion, fire grate reversing operation.Unburnt particle has part to bump with face arch and falls back to and burn away on the fire grate, and particularly the utility model is big with the commentaries on classics of face arch design, and promptly end points surpasses the burner hearth center line, makes the resume combustion effect of uncombusted particle fairly obvious.Rise in the S shape passage that flue gas is formed by face arch in burner hearth, prolonged the tail-off time of particle.Flue gas is separated uncombusted carbon containing flying dust through separator after entering reversal chamber, falls into ash bucket, and second-time burning is carried out at the rear portion that is sent to burner hearth counter-rotating fire grate through ash feeding pipe again.Separator, ash feeding pipe are arranged in the boiler, can need power that the carbon containing flying dust is sent into fire grate, can not produce the flying dust phenomenon.For the cleaning of ash feeding pipe, on ash feeding pipe, be provided with blowing mouth 6.
In conjunction with Fig. 2.Second kind of embodiment of the present utility model is to be dry collector 7 with separator designs, and it is installed on before the wet scrubber of boiler, and ash feeding pipe extend into the rear wall or the sidewall of burner hearth.Air blast 8 is arranged behind the dry collector, the carbon containing flying dust is introduced burner hearth, this structure relatively is suitable for the transformation to existing spreader stoker boliler.
